Course Requirements
The course consists of ten instructional units that students complete on their own time, within a 90-day period of registering for the course. Each unit includes required supplementary readings in addition to the online content. There is an online exam that students take upon completion of the units. Students who complete the course and pass the exam receive a certificate from the University of Miami School of Architecture.
